Pingshan Cultural Cluster Book Mall

Pingshan Cultural Cluster - Book Mall, taking the local Hakka enclosed house culture as the design concept and the pattern of round outside but square inside as the main feature, has its space divided into "Square" and "Round" zones. The square zone is oriented to young people, the overall layout of which expands around the central activity area. Inspired by "Diaolou" (tower building), we adopt the highly structured facade of Diaolou to create characteristic walls for the atrium. The use of mirror finish ceiling makes the image extend infinitely, activating the memory to the whole space.

Kanglaibo

It is a design case for a resort hotel with an indoor area of 16,000 square meters and 19 floors. The hotel is in the Baianshan National Forest Park of Jiangxi Province. The designer creates ethnic-cultural characteristics that given the hotel a unique personality. Moreover, the designer designed a water-saving system for the hotel’s hot-spring bath in the air and each guest room. The system guarantees the user experience of tourists and effectively saves the natural hot-spring resources.

The Rossmore Penthouse

The Rossmore Penthouse is part of the new contemporary luxury apartment building located in Hancock Park, Los Angeles. The interior of the penthouse boasts a 3-level extravagant unit inspired by Art Deco elements. The use of natural materials and CLT provides a luxurious, airy feel that merges old-world charm with contemporary design. The unit features a sculptural staircase that wraps around an open-sky garden, inviting the serenity of the outdoors into the penthouse - whether it be a bright sunny day or a calm rainy evening.
